@@sarahlovee4229 Note: This is maybe a bit more graphic than usual comments; please be warned as needed. I'm not trying to be gross--just a few observations. 1) Often ppl who cut off part of a body make multiple cuts that are very sloppy. They stop and reposition the knife several times, use multiple blades and/or partly pull apart the hacked-up joints as they get frustrated, scared, etc. It can look a lot like an animal. 2) Some animal bites can be much cleaner than you'd think. This is especially true if soft tissue has already decayed a bit and/or another scavenger has already been there. Some animals make exploratory bites (that do not damage bone) until they find a vulnerable joint. This often happens if an animal doesn't feel safe eating where the corpse is located. It will bite off part and drags it elsewhere to eat. It looks VERY clean. It isn't like a pet dog with a bone. 3) While a specialist can often tell the difference between bites and cuts, it becomes more difficult if the skeleton is weathered because the cut marks lose detail. In other words, the longer it's exposed to elements, the more dulled and "generic" the cut/bite marks become. Add to this that not every jurisdiction has access to every kind of specialist AND that individual specialists often disagree with each other. 4) I share your frustration that this kind of thing happens. I'm just saying it's not surprising and not always due to negligence. Interpreting evidence can be aggravatingly inexact.
